Range of Treatment



Emergency situation dental care concentrates on dealing with urgent dental issues such as extreme toothaches or injuries that call for immediate focus. When you experience unexpected and intense pain, swelling, bleeding, or injury to your teeth or gum tissues, looking for prompt treatment from an emergency dental practitioner is essential. These specialized oral professionals are outfitted to manage serious cases that can not wait for a normal consultation.

Whether it's a knocked-out tooth, a broken tooth, or intolerable discomfort, emergency dental care gives timely relief and necessary treatment to alleviate your discomfort.

Reaction Time



For urgent dental issues, punctual response time plays a vital role in reducing pain and protecting against more complications. When facing an oral emergency, such as extreme toothaches, knocked-out teeth, or sudden swelling, time is important. Looking for instant care from an emergency dental practitioner can make a considerable difference in the outcome of your scenario. Delays in treatment can't just extend your discomfort however also boost the threat of infection or irreversible damage to your teeth and periodontals.

In contrast, routine dentistry consultations are usually set up in advance for regular exams, cleansings, or non-urgent procedures. While these visits are important for preserving oral wellness, they're generally not implied to resolve urgent issues that require instant attention. Normal dentistry concentrates on preventive care and long-lasting therapy planning as opposed to on-the-spot interventions for severe problems.



As a result, when confronted with an unexpected dental trouble that can't wait, it's critical to prioritize quick action and seek assistance from an emergency dentist to attend to the concern immediately and successfully.

Cost and Insurance policy



Thinking about the financial aspect of dental care, comprehending the distinctions in expense and insurance policy coverage between emergency dental care and normal dentistry is crucial. Emergency situation dentistry typically features a greater price contrasted to routine oral services. Since emergency situations generally require prompt focus, the expenses might consist of after-hours costs or expedited solutions, which can add to the total cost.

On the other hand, normal dental care usually involves organized visits for preventative care, routine check-ups, and usual treatments like cleanings and fillings, which are usually a lot more affordable.

When it concerns insurance policy protection, emergency oral solutions may occasionally have actually limited alternatives accepted by service providers, leading to prospective out-of-pocket expenses for clients. On the other hand, normal dental care is generally more aligned with conventional insurance coverage strategies, making it simpler for patients to use their protection and decrease individual prices.

Before looking for oral therapy, it's a good idea to consult both your dental practitioner and insurance coverage carrier to recognize the insurance coverage offered for emergency situation versus regular dental services.
